Output 50dfcbc71dd0e97a97bfccabd375d0d2879a24a7b4ea1a8d565d9c5a96ff9aa7:1

value
301136900
script pubkey
OP_0 OP_PUSHBYTES_20 8ee803f91a7dba8c7c0b73601742e2c50b0523e8
address
ltc1q3m5q87g60kagclqtwdspwshzc59s2glgxf20jn
transaction
50dfcbc71dd0e97a97bfccabd375d0d2879a24a7b4ea1a8d565d9c5a96ff9aa7
spent
true